Figure 490: Data logger channel configuration settings
The following settings are available for all 16 data logger channels.
Signal
Range: any FlexAnalog parameter
Default: Off
This setting selects the metering value to be recorded for the data logger channel.
Name
Range: up to 12 alphanumeric characters
Default: Channel 1
This setting specifies the name of the data logger channel.
Mode
Range: Max, Min, Mean
Default: Mean
This setting defines which value (maximum, minimum, or mean) is written to the data
logger.
Alarming
Range: Disabled, Self-Reset, Latched
Default: Disabled
When this setting is "Disabled," alarming is inhibited. When set to "Self-Reset," alarms
are reset as soon as the signal drops below the pickup value. When set to "Latched," the
alarms remain active until the reset input is asserted.
Reset Alarms
Range: any metering logic operand or shared operand
Default: OFF
The alarms are reset when the operand assigned to this setting is asserted and the
Alarming
setting is selected as "Latched."
Reset Statistics
Range: any metering logic operand or shared operand
Default: OFF
The maximum, minimum, time of maximum, and time of minimum statistics are reset
when the operand assigned to this setting is asserted.
